General Storage Conditions
When it comes to storing moly TZM, the most important thing is to keep it in a dry environment. Moisture is the enemy of moly TZM because it can cause oxidation, which in turn can degrade the material's properties. You want to aim for a relative humidity of less than 60%. If you can, try to keep it even lower, around 30 - 40%.
Temperature also plays a big role. Moly TZM can handle high temperatures during its use, but for storage, it's best to keep it at a stable, moderate temperature. A room temperature of around 20 - 25°C (68 - 77°F) is ideal. Avoid storing it in areas where the temperature fluctuates wildly, like near heaters or in uninsulated sheds.
Protection from Contaminants
Another crucial aspect of storage is protecting moly TZM from contaminants. Dust, dirt, and other particles can adhere to the surface of the material and potentially cause damage. You should store moly TZM in sealed containers or plastic bags to keep it clean. If the material is in the form of bars or rods, you can use protective sleeves.
Chemical contaminants are also a concern. Moly TZM can react with certain chemicals, so it's important to keep it away from substances like acids, alkalis, and strong oxidizing agents. If you're storing it in a workshop or a warehouse, make sure it's separated from areas where these chemicals are used or stored.

TZM Molybdenum Alloy Bar
TZM Molybdenum Alloy Bar is a common form of moly TZM. These bars can be stored in racks or on pallets. When using racks, make sure they are sturdy and can support the weight of the bars. If you're using pallets, cover them with plastic sheets to protect the bars from dust and moisture. You can also stack the bars neatly, but be careful not to stack them too high to avoid deformation.

Monitoring and Inspection
Regular monitoring and inspection are essential for proper storage. Check the storage area regularly for signs of moisture, like condensation on the containers or rust on the material. Inspect the moly TZM itself for any signs of damage, such as cracks or discoloration. If you notice any issues, take immediate action to address them.
Long - term Storage
For long - term storage, you may want to consider additional measures. You can apply a thin layer of protective coating on the moly TZM to prevent oxidation. There are special anti - oxidation coatings available in the market that are suitable for moly TZM. Also, if you're storing a large quantity of moly TZM, you might want to consider using a climate - controlled storage facility. This ensures that the temperature and humidity are kept at optimal levels over an extended period.
